× This immediately because they are not only comfortable but also allowed me an easy sense of movement.
✓ This is because they are not only comfortable but also allow me an easy range of movement.
The original sentence omits the linking verb 'is' and uses 'allowed' (past tense) incorrectly. Use 'is' to link 'This' to the explanation, and use present tense 'allow' to match the general statement about T-shirts. Also 'sense of movement' is unnatural; 'range of movement' is clearer.
× Umm. Moreover, they are also quite flexible that I can match them well with my withdrawal.
✓ Moreover, they are quite versatile so I can match them well with my wardrobe.
The conjunction 'that' is misused here. Use 'so' or 'which allows me to' to link cause and effect. 'Flexible' is better as 'versatile' when describing clothing, and 'withdrawal' is a wrong word choice; 'wardrobe' is correct.

× Uh, I usually refill my T-shirt collections around twice or three times a year.
✓ I usually refresh my T-shirt collection about two or three times a year.
'Refill' and 'collections' are awkward collocations here. Use 'refresh' or 'update' and the singular 'collection'. Use 'about two or three times' instead of 'around twice or three times' for correct quantifier phrasing.
× Umm, for example, whenever I come across AT shirt that catches my eyes, umm, I definitely purchase them without hesitation.
✓ For example, whenever I come across a T-shirt that catches my eye, I definitely buy it without hesitation.
Sentence structure needed correction: use article 'a' before 'T-shirt', singular 'eye' not 'eyes' with 'catches', and 'buy it' to agree in number with 'a T-shirt'. Also 'AT shirt' seems to be a typo for 'a T-shirt'.
× Umm teachers are really functionable.
✓ T-shirts are really functional.
'Teachers' is a typo for 'T-shirts'. 'Functionable' is not standard; use 'functional' as the adjective. Ensure subject matches intended noun.

× Yes, with the exceptions.
✓ Yes, with some exceptions.
'With the exceptions' is unidiomatic. Use 'with some exceptions' to express that there are exceptions.
× Since I was a little girl, I found myself as a dynamic and active person, uh, making T-shirt, uh, always my go to choice.
✓ Since I was a little girl, I found myself to be a dynamic and active person, so T-shirts were always my go-to choice.
Use 'found myself to be' rather than 'found myself as'. 'Making' is incorrect; use 'so' to link cause and effect. 'T-shirt' should be plural 'T-shirts' and 'go-to' needs a hyphen.
× Umm, for example, uh, I, the teachers served perfectly for my daily purposes, uh, such as playing outside with my friends without being sweat.
✓ For example, they served me perfectly for my daily activities, such as playing outside with my friends without getting sweaty.
The phrase 'I, the teachers' is incorrect; likely meant 'they'. 'Served perfectly' is okay but needs object 'me'. 'Daily purposes' is unnatural; use 'daily activities'. 'Without being sweat' is ungrammatical; use 'without getting sweaty'.
